Aiyedatiwa Reiterates Commitment to Quality Education As Key To Tackling Poverty

Ondo State Governor, Lucky Aiyedatiwa, has reaffirmed that quality education remains crucial to eradicating poverty and sustaining peace in society, restating his administration’s resolve to build a globally competitive education system.

Aiyedatiwa made the remarks at the third edition of an educational empowerment programme sponsored by the Speaker of the Ondo State House of Assembly, Rt. Hon. Olamide Oladiji, held at the Oba Adesanoye Civic Centre in Ondo City.

Represented by his deputy, Olayide Adelami, the governor underscored the transformative role of education in national development.

“Today’s event is not just another ceremony; it is a bold statement of our collective belief that no investment yields greater dividends than investment in education, the bedrock of any society. It is also an affirmation of our conviction that every child, regardless of background or circumstance, deserves a fair opportunity to learn, to dream, and to achieve their highest potential,” Aiyedatiwa said.

He commended the Speaker for sustaining the scholarship initiative, describing it as a programme with far-reaching benefits for his constituents.

“I congratulate the Speaker of the Ondo State House of Assembly for this laudable programme, which has been touching the lives of people in his constituency, especially the vulnerable. I commend your commitment to making this empowerment programme an annual event,” the governor added.

In his remarks, the Speaker said the programme was borne out of his desire to use education as a tool to break generational poverty and give back to society.

“This initiative is fully in line with the ‘OUR EASE’ development agenda of Governor Lucky Aiyedatiwa, which seeks to create an environment where life is easier, opportunities are more accessible, and development is people-oriented,” Oladiji said.
